NAME

Paws::EC2::DescribeReservedInstancesListings - Arguments for method DescribeReservedInstancesListings on Paws::EC2

DESCRIPTION

This class represents the parameters used for calling the method DescribeReservedInstancesListings on the Amazon Elastic Compute Cloud service. Use the attributes of this class as arguments to method DescribeReservedInstancesListings.

You shouln't make instances of this class. Each attribute should be used as a named argument in the call to DescribeReservedInstancesListings.

As an example:

  $service_obj->DescribeReservedInstancesListings(Att1 => $value1, Att2 => $value2, ...);

Values for attributes that are native types (Int, String, Float, etc) can passed as-is (scalar values). Values for complex Types (objects) can be passed as a HashRef. The keys and values of the hashref will be used to instance the underlying object.

ATTRIBUTES

Filters => ArrayRef[Paws::EC2::Filter]

One or more filters.

  • reserved-instances-id - The ID of the Reserved Instances.

  • reserved-instances-listing-id - The ID of the Reserved Instances listing.

  • status - The status of the Reserved Instance listing (pending | active | cancelled | closed).

  • status-message - The reason for the status.

ReservedInstancesId => Str

One or more Reserved Instance IDs.

ReservedInstancesListingId => Str

One or more Reserved Instance Listing IDs.
